Seared Salmon with Garlic Green Beans and Brown Rice

INGREDIENTS
5 oz Salmon Fillet
1 cup Fresh Green Beans
2/3 cup Cooked Brown Rice
1 clove Garlic, minced
1 tsp Olive Oil
1 tbsp Lemon Juice
Salt and Pepper to taste
PREPARATION
Pat the salmon dry and season lightly with salt and pepper on both sides.
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and add olive oil.
Once the oil is hot, place the salmon fillet skin-side down and sear for about 3-4 minutes until a golden crust forms.
Flip the salmon and cook for another 3-4 minutes until the fish is cooked through but still moist. Squeeze a bit of lemon juice over the top during the final minute.
In a separate pan, heat a small amount of olive oil over medium heat and add the minced garlic. Sauté until fragrant, about 30 seconds.
Add the fresh green beans to the garlic oil and sauté for 4-5 minutes until they are tender-crisp. Season with a pinch of salt and pepper.
Reheat your pre-cooked brown rice if needed or fluff it up in a pan with a splash of water.
Plate the salmon alongside the garlic green beans and brown rice, and finish with a drizzle of lemon juice for extra brightness.
